Mission: Defending the title in the 24H Series Europe
After last year's triumph, the mission to defend the title for the racing team from Bavaria is on the agenda in 2026. The team competes in the Europe-wide endurance series with a Porsche 911 GT3 R and a powerful line-up.
A total of five races are on the program, which the team will contest. Jörg Dreisow, Manuel Lauck and Constantin Dressler, who were successful last year, are also part of the line-up this year. The trio will be supported by two experienced champions over the course of the season: Dennis Marschall, reigning champion in the Bronze Cup class of the GT World Challenge Europe, will take the wheel at the 12 Hours of Mugello. In the remaining rounds, Porsche contract driver Joel Sturm, who won the LMGT3 classification in the FIA WEC in 2024, will compete as the fourth driver for the Hofkirchen-based company.
The vehicle, driver and team are now ready to build on the extremely successful previous season. At the 24-hour race in Barcelona, the racing team managed to celebrate the title in the GT3 classification of the series. In addition, there was also victory in the GT3 Pro-Am classification to celebrate. Successes like these underline that the team is also one of the top teams in endurance racing.

The season of the Michelin 24h Series Europe starts at the end of March with the 12h Mugello, before it concludes after five stops in September with the 24h Barcelona. For the first time, the series will hold a 12-hour race at the Nürburgring in July. All races can be followed on the official YouTube channel of the racing series.
